#ce2dbf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#ce2dbf is composed of 80.8% red, 17.6% green and 74.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 78.2% magenta, 7.3% yellow and 19.2% black. It has a hue angle of 305.6 degrees, a saturation of 64.1% and a lightness of 49.2%. #ce2dbf color hex could be obtained by blending #ff5aff with #9d007f. Closest websafe color is: #cc33cc.

Shades and Tints of #ce2dbf

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0d030c is the darkest color, while #fefcfe is the lightest one.

Tones of #ce2dbf

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#817a80 is the less saturated color, while #f506de is the most saturated one.
